About Event

The EV revolution for passenger vehicles is well under way - but what about big rigs? In the US, heavy duty trucks contribute about 7% of total GHG emissions, but the good news is incredible progress is being made in this notionally hard-to-abate sector. Hear from carriers, logistics service providers, and cargo owners who are leading the charge on zero emission freight.

This event is for corporate sustainability directors, cargo owners looking to reduce scope three emissions, and fans of climate solutions that also lower costs - participants will learn about the current state of play and the road ahead to developing zero emission freight solutions.
